![]() ![]() Click on the Credentials menu on the left.Therefore, you must create a set of API keys for it and restrict its permissions to reduce the chances of unauthorized usage. It is important to note that the access to the Google Map APIs is not free. Click Maps SDK for Android and then click Enable.Click Maps SDK for iOS and then click Enable.Once the project is created, you’ll have to enable the Maps API SDK for both Android and iOS. Head to the Google Developers Console and click the already-selected project.Ĭlick on the current project name again and you should see your new project created in the list. This is required because you’ll need APIs to integrate Google Maps in your app. The very first step is to create a project at Google Developers Console. Modifying your maps with the GoogleMap widgetĬreating a project in Google Cloud Platform.Adding Google Maps in Flutter (Android).Creating a project in Google Cloud Platform.In this tutorial, we’ll show you how to use the official plugin for integrating Google Maps in your Flutter app. We use it for everything from finding directions to a destination, to searching for a nearby restaurant or gas station, to just zooming in and out of the map to see the street view of any location on the planet.Īdding Google Maps to your mobile app can open up a whole new world to your users - literally. I can’t imagine what life would be like without Google Maps. Using Google Maps to add maps in Flutter applicationsĮditor’s note: This post was updated on 23 September 2022. Over the last seven-plus years, I've been developing and leading various mobile apps in different areas. If you want to learn more about Google Earth Engine, check out EO Data Science's top ten Google Earth Engine tips and tricks here.Pinkesh Darji Follow I love to solve problems using technology that improves users' lives on a major scale. The tool is still in an experimental stage, so there may still be new features to come as well! However, it is a great place to start for anyone who has not coded for an Earth Engine App before and further customisation is always possible after exporting the template into the Earth Engine Code Editor. There are some limitations to the App Creator, such as not being able to add more than one panel to a map, or having multiple widgets in a row. I will not go into detail as this will require another full tutorial, but here is what my functioning Rainfall Data Explorer app might look like: The final step to creating a working app is to add data, as well as callback functions for the widgets within Code Editor. Return to Google Earth Engine’s Code Editor, paste the code, and your app template should show up when you run the code. To add widgets to your app, navigate to ‘Widgets’ and simply drag and drop them to the desired position.Ĭlicking on each widget will show its attributes, and this is where you can customise them as much or as little as you like.Ĭlick on ‘Export’ in the top right corner of the screen to copy the code for your app template. In this case, I decided to switch from a right side panel to a left side panel, and change from the ‘silver’ palette to the ‘light’ palette. If you don’t like what you selected, navigate to ‘Templates’ on the left panel to change the template, or change the palette using the dropdown menu above the app display. The palette and template can always be changed later - so don’t worry if you change your mind. Name your app, select a palette and a template. In the below example we create a Rainfall Data Explorer with the new App Creator. I have put together some simple steps to help you get started creating your own app. How to build an Earth Engine App using the App Creator There is then one final step to bring this app back into the Earth Engine Code Editor by exporting the template created in App Creator. Users are able to easily select a layout and palette, drag-and-drop widgets as they like, and finally customise those widgets all with a simple user interface. However, with the App Creator, the steps required to code for every panel, widget and attribute from scratch is eliminated. ![]() Typically, users would have to code for their app within Earth Engine Code Editor. This can be useful for quickly sharing results with collaborators and decision makers in an interactive manner. The app can be viewed by anyone, even if they are not Earth Engine users. ![]() At the Geo for Good Summit 2020, David Gibson, Software Engineer at Google, announced the App Creator which allows users to easily build an Earth Engine App interface.Įarth Engine Apps are dynamic user interfaces for sharing your Earth Engine analyses and results online.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|